[Kernel][Yank555][Sammy 4.3 v4.1c][Sammy 4.1.2 v3.4f]

  • 8.834 Antworten
  • Letztes Antwortdatum
Du musst eine "Linux Swap" Partition erstellen ;) Ich benutze für sowas immer Gparted unter Linux.
 
jo, habe ich nun mal gemacht... .mit dem minitool geht das schon.

aber keine veränderung... die swap taucht nicht auf in dem diskinfotool :(
 
Hast du einen SD Kartenleser? Schnapp dir alternativ ein ISO von "Parted Magic", brenne eine CD oder erstelle über unetbootin ( unter Linux ) einen USB Bootstick und partitioner damit die Karte? Ich habe bis jetzt mit Windows Tools, meistens nur suboptimale Ergebnisse erzielt ( manche haben nicht einmal die Funktion, "flags" von Partitionen zu verändern ).
 
naja, yank hat ja in dem thread geschrieben mit dem minitool geht es.

somit denke ich muss es auch gehen... aber dann gibts halt keine swap :)
für mich alles swehr verwirrend irgendwie...

bin eigentlich nicht ganz unerfahren und hab mit dem htc touch damals angefangen...übers s1,s2 nun s3... nur mit swap noch nie was gemacht.
naja, vielleicht kann yank ja noch den wink mit dem zaunpfahl geben :)
 
Hallo
Ich habe auch 137 apps drauf und mein S3 läuft super flüssig und echt schnell,auch bei downloads ist es schön schnell,dieses Hardswap denke ich kann nicht so viel an der Performance ändern das es noch schneller läuft.Und wenn doch!dann in ein bereich wo man es enicht merkt.

gruß T-D
 
Also zum Hardswap :

Die SD-Card muß wie folgt partitioniert werden :

Partition 1 : primär FAT32
Partition 2 : primär Linux Swap

Dann Kernel flashen und Hardswap = ja angeben, damit die Partition formatiert wird und das Aktivationsscript instaliert wird.

Schneller wird mit Hardswap keine App, das geht nur mit schnellerer CPU ;)

Aber das hin und her wechseln zwischen Apps sollte schneller werden, weil eben ausgeswapt werden kann, demnach ein dauerndes schliessen / starten seltener wird.

In meiem Kernel OP unter LMK und Virtual Memory lesen, erklärt dies hier etwas päziser ;)

JP.

Sent from my custom ARHD 14.0 / Yank555.lu JB kernel v2.4a Aroma (JB-U6 / Linux 3.0.51) powered Galaxy S3 i9300 using Tapatalk 2
 
  • Danke
Reaktionen: Klaus-DK, diddsen und Gene S
ok, es hat funktioniert, nachdem ich NOCHMALS den kernel und einstellungen flashte.

was mir noch icht ganz klar ist... es gibt ja da wo die option zu hardswap ist auch das mit swappiness... was soll man da einstellen?
hab es auf default stock 100mb gelassen.

das diskinfo zeigt nun die swap, aber warum ist es zum syseigenen taskmanager unterschiedlich??
im taskmanager unter ram wird z.b. 120mb als frei angezeigt und in dem infotool 1% ^^
was stimmt nun?
und warum ist so wenig frei (falls diskinfo stimmt) wenn lmk auf mittel gewählt?
 
yank555 schrieb:
Also zum Hardswap :

Die SD-Card muß wie folgt partitioniert werden :

Partition 1 : primär FAT32
Partition 2 : primär Linux Swap

Dann Kernel flashen und Hardswap = ja angeben, damit die Partition formatiert wird und das Aktivationsscript instaliert wird.

Perfekt wie geschrieben gemacht, und siehe da Hardswap ist da. :thumbup:
 
@Yank555

So erstes Fazit zur v2.4a, nachdem ich gestern mein System komplett neu gemacht habe läuft Dein Kernel seit 18 Std. und aktull habe ich noch 76% Akku.Was mir sehr gut gefällt ist,wenn ich z.B. telefoniert habe oder im Inet war etc. und ich den Bildschirm sperre das mein S3 sofort wieder in den Deepsleep geht mit 97%. Da muss ich sagen davon bin ich schwer beeindruckt (gut das hatte ich bei Deinen anderen Versionen auch) aber was noch dazu kommt ist das es funktioniert,das der Kernel wirklich nur soweit taktet wie angegeben.

Gruß "D"
 
diddsen schrieb:
ok, es hat funktioniert, nachdem ich NOCHMALS den kernel und einstellungen flashte.

was mir noch icht ganz klar ist... es gibt ja da wo die option zu hardswap ist auch das mit swappiness... was soll man da einstellen?
hab es auf default stock 100mb gelassen.

das diskinfo zeigt nun die swap, aber warum ist es zum syseigenen taskmanager unterschiedlich??
im taskmanager unter ram wird z.b. 120mb als frei angezeigt und in dem infotool 1% ^^
was stimmt nun?
und warum ist so wenig frei (falls diskinfo stimmt) wenn lmk auf mittel gewählt?

Swappiness it ein Faktor, kann zwischen 0 und 100 liegen (sind keine Mb). 0 heisst Swap Verwendung vermeiden, 100 heisst Swap soviel es geht verwenden.

Zum Unterschied zwischen freiem Speicher :

DiskInfo zeigt Linux Daten, genau wie free, Android aber sieht das anders. Cache ist für Android als frei angesehen, weil es leicht frei gemacht werden kann, Linux aber betrachted als frei was nicht benutzt ist, cach also als belegt angesehen wird.

Das hier oben stammt aus Comments im Sourcecode des Kernels im LMK Source um genau zu sein.

Zumdem frage ich mich ob Android nicht einfach den freien Speicher der Dalvik VM anzeigt, dieser wäre von Linux aus gesehen aber belegt, weil die Dalvik VM diesen RAM ja von Linux in Anspuch genommen hat...

JP.

Sent from my custom ARHD 14.0 / Yank555.lu JB kernel v2.4a Aroma (JB-U6 / Linux 3.0.51) powered Galaxy S3 i9300 using Tapatalk 2
 
  • Danke
Reaktionen: diddsen
Off Topik:

Ich habe heute mal ein Benchmark Test gemacht,
SiyahKernel S3-v1.7rc3 gegenYank555.lu kernel v2.4a

Die Performenz vom Yank555.lu kernel v2.4a ist bei weitem besser.

Klar ist welcher Kernel auf mein S3 beibt.
 
@KlausDK

Sorry aber Benchmark Test= sinnlos

1. kommen immer andere Werte raus ( nochmal in ner Std. testen und staunen)

2.Sind das zwei verschiedene Kernel....

3.Jeder fährt andere Einstellungen und eine andere Rom....

4. ergo nicht Aussagekräftig....

Gruß "D"

 
  • Danke
Reaktionen: -stephan-
Mir ist die gefühlte Performance immer wichtiger gewesen als das Ergebnis irgendeines Benchmarks. Selbst wenn der v2.4a im Benchmark "verloren" hätte, würde ich nicht im Traum daran denken, ihn derzeit gegen einen anderen Kernel zu ersetzen.

Gruß Stephan
 
kann ich denn kern einfach über denn cf root kern flashen?

mfg
 
CF root ist kein Kernel,Du kannst den Yank555 Kernel so drüber flashen im recovery
 
Zuletzt bearbeitet:
@ "D"
welches ROM benutzt du? Ich glaube ich muss mal weg von der CheckRom, will mal was neues :D
 
mbs schrieb:
kann ich denn kern einfach über denn ist ein Kerncf root kern flashen?

mfg


Was ist ein Kern?....:confused2:

Ich kenne nur Kernel....

Gruß "D"
 
ja okay kernel:D
 
yank555 schrieb:
Swappiness it ein Faktor, kann zwischen 0 und 100 liegen (sind keine Mb). 0 heisst Swap Verwendung vermeiden, 100 heisst Swap soviel es geht verwenden.

Zum Unterschied zwischen freiem Speicher :

DiskInfo zeigt Linux Daten, genau wie free, Android aber sieht das anders. Cache ist für Android als frei angesehen, weil es leicht frei gemacht werden kann, Linux aber betrachted als frei was nicht benutzt ist, cach also als belegt angesehen wird.

Das hier oben stammt aus Comments im Sourcecode des Kernels im LMK Source um genau zu sein.

Zumdem frage ich mich ob Android nicht einfach den freien Speicher der Dalvik VM anzeigt, dieser wäre von Linux aus gesehen aber belegt, weil die Dalvik VM diesen RAM ja von Linux in Anspuch genommen hat...

JP.

Sent from my custom ARHD 14.0 / Yank555.lu JB kernel v2.4a Aroma (JB-U6 / Linux 3.0.51) powered Galaxy S3 i9300 using Tapatalk 2

So nun endlich wieder zu Hause beim PC, wollte nämlich hier noch mehr Details zu lieferen, aber auf dem Händy ging das einfach schlecht...

Auszug aus den LowMemoryKiller Sourcen :

/* drivers/misc/lowmemorykiller.c
*
* The lowmemorykiller driver lets user-space specify a set of memory thresholds
* where processes with a range of oom_adj values will get killed. Specify the
* minimum oom_adj values in /sys/module/lowmemorykiller/parameters/adj and the
* number of free pages in /sys/module/lowmemorykiller/parameters/minfree. Both
* files take a comma separated list of numbers in ascending order.
*
* For example, write "0,8" to /sys/module/lowmemorykiller/parameters/adj and
* "1024,4096" to /sys/module/lowmemorykiller/parameters/minfree to kill processes
* with a oom_adj value of 8 or higher when the free memory drops below 4096 pages
* and kill processes with a oom_adj value of 0 or higher when the free memory
* drops below 1024 pages.
*
* The driver considers memory used for caches to be free, but if a large
* percentage of the cached memory is locked this can be very inaccurate
* and processes may not get killed until the normal oom killer is triggered.

*
* Copyright (C) 2007-2008 Google, Inc.
*
* This software is licensed under the terms of the GNU General Public
* License version 2, as published by the Free Software Foundation, and
* may be copied, distributed, and modified under those terms.
*
* This program is distributed in the hope that it will be useful,
* but WITHOUT ANY WARRANTY; without even the implied warranty of
* M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the
* GNU General Public License for more details.
*
*/
 
  • Danke
Reaktionen: diddsen und Gene S

Ähnliche Themen

Oebbler
Antworten
9
Aufrufe
5.752
SiggiP
S
Oebbler
Antworten
37
Aufrufe
14.662
Borkse
B
Oebbler
Antworten
3
Aufrufe
3.207
SaschaKH
SaschaKH
Zurück
Oben Unten